Default Re: am i overthinking this draw?

Limping with 87s is ok, but your implied odds are shrinking fast after the preflop raise, but the chance of stacking an opponent rises with the raise. I'd fold preflop after the raise, but I'm tight as a very tight thing.

On the flop you most likely need a straight flush to win. If your opponents doesn't already have a boat, then at least two of your flush outs will make them a boat, leaving you with at most 7 outs and no way of knowing which are good. Those 7 outs must be counted down due to reverse implied odds, you making the flush and no boat, the boat can still come on the river approx. 6 outs to your opponents. That will leave you with 5 outs or thereabouts if we are optimistic. Not even close to getting implied odds. Fold on flop.
